Tea Ceremony in 150 Years Old Townhouse with Tables and Chairs

What You’ll Experience Learn the history and cultural significance of the tea ceremony. Explore tea utensils, their uses, and care tips. Practice proper tea etiquette and serving techniques. Enjoy a demonstration of the ceremony's elegant movements and seasonal hospitality. Prepare matcha yourself to experience the essence of the practice. Participate in a Q&A session. This experience is especially recommended for those who: Have a genuine interest in Japanese culture, aesthetics, and traditional arts. Can appreciate the authentic taste of real matcha. Value the delicate flavors of handcrafted wagashi (traditional Japanese sweets) from a long-established shop. Please note: This is not a tea ceremony experience designed merely for sightseeing or social media photos. It is a cultural experience intended for those who seek a deeper understanding.
